Description

Malicious code in checkout-use-toasts (npm)

Source: amazon-inspector

On require() of checkout-use-toasts, index.js loads _bridge.js which fetches an OS/architecture-specific native binary from runtime-assembled Cloudflare workers.dev hosts (oob-worker.cf100/cf101/cf102-*.workers.dev) with a DNS-TXT fallback that resolves TXT records at subdomains of dl.wel1.ru and concatenates base64-decoded chunks as the payload. The bytes are written to /var/tmp/.cache_<hex> (or %TEMP%\dotnet_diag_<hex>.exe on Windows) under disguised names, chmod 0755, and spawned detached via /bin/sh -c or cmd /c start /b. Destination hostnames are split into fragments and joined at runtime (['oob-worker.cf102-baf.wor','ke','rs','.d','ev'].join(''); ['sdk.d','l.','we','l1.','ru'].join('')) to evade static string matching. There is no signature or version pinning on the fetched payload. The package name and stated purpose (toast notifications for checkout flows) do not match downloading and executing a native binary, and the DNS-TXT covert channel is designed to bypass HTTP egress controls. Installing or importing this package results in attacker-controlled code execution on the installer's machine.
